Biomass Power Generation Brazil, Sao Paolo, 18-19 September 2012
As a world leader in bioenergy industry meetings, Green Power Conferences welcomes you to Biomass Power Generation Brazil. This two day information and networking conference will provide both new potential entrants and established energy market professionals the chance to hear from and meet with the thought leaders, regulators, financiers, utility companies, policy makers, engineers, technology providers and biomass producers who are driving the biomass-fired power sector forward in Brazil.
What will be debated?
- Understanding cogeneration and its economic and environmental benefits
- The importance of clean power supply to the energy strategies of Brazilian industrial giants
- How ethanol producers of all sizes are integrating CHP into their production line
- Recent advances in cogeneration technologies
- Government and Utilities’ policies and the economics of biomass power in Brazil
- Good carbon management and the economic viability of biopower projects
- Developing dedicated, low-cost, large-scale sources of biomass
- Driving Brazil’s wood-to-biopower sector with sustainability in mind
- Turning waste into money: biomass export markets and the potential of torrefaction
